John Deere 200 D Excavator Specs
The John Deere 200 D Excavator is a reliable machine for construction and heavy-duty tasks. With its robust engine and efficient hydraulic system, it’s built for both power and precision. Here are the key specifications:
Engine Power: The JD 200 D is equipped with a 6.8-liter, 6-cylinder diesel engine that produces approximately 123 horsepower (92 kW), ensuring it has the power to handle challenging projects without compromise.
Operating Weight: Weighing around 20,000 kg (44,092 lbs), the 200 D strikes a balance between portability and strength, making it suitable for a range of work sites.
Digging Depth: The maximum digging depth is 6.5 meters (21.3 ft), allowing operators to tackle deep excavation tasks with ease.
Bucket Capacity: This model can accommodate buckets with capacities ranging from 0.6 to 1.2 cubic meters (0.79 to 1.57 cubic yards), offering flexibility depending on the job’s demands.
Lift Capacity: With a lift capacity of up to 6,700 kg (14,770 lbs) at full reach, the John Deere 200 D can handle heavy lifting with confidence.
Hydraulic System: The hydraulic pump delivers a flow rate of 200 liters per minute (52.8 gallons per minute), providing the power necessary for quick and smooth operation of attachments and digging tools.
Fuel Tank Capacity: The excavator’s fuel tank holds 350 liters (92.5 gallons), offering extended operating time between refueling sessions, ideal for long workdays.
Dimensions: The JD 200 D has a length of 10.2 meters (33.5 ft) and a width of 3.0 meters (9.8 ft), which allows it to maneuver effectively while offering stability during operations.
Travel Speed: The travel speed reaches up to 5.5 km/h (3.4 mph), ensuring the excavator can quickly move between work sites or shift positions on the job site.
With these specs, the John Deere 200 D Excavator is designed to meet the demands of both small and large-scale projects, providing power, stability, and efficiency in one package.

Maintenance and Service Intervals for John Deere 200 D Excavator
Regular maintenance is key to keeping the John Deere 200 D Excavator running smoothly. Follow these guidelines for optimal performance and longevity.
- Engine Oil Change: Replace engine oil every 500 hours of operation. Use high-quality oil that meets the engine manufacturer’s specifications.
- Oil Filter Replacement: Change the oil filter with every oil change to ensure clean lubrication and proper engine performance.
- Fuel Filter Replacement: Inspect and replace the fuel filter every 500 hours. A clean filter ensures optimal fuel flow and prevents engine damage.
- Air Filter Maintenance: Clean the air filter every 250 hours. Replace it if it shows signs of wear or clogging. A clean air filter improves engine efficiency and reduces fuel consumption.
- Hydraulic System: Check hydraulic fluid levels and inspect the system for leaks every 250 hours. Change the hydraulic fluid and filter at least every 2000 hours.
- Cooling System: Inspect coolant levels and condition regularly. Replace the coolant every 2000 hours or as recommended by the manufacturer.
- Undercarriage Inspection: Check the undercarriage, including tracks, rollers, and sprockets, every 500 hours. Tighten any loose bolts and replace worn parts to prevent uneven wear.
- Battery Maintenance: Clean battery terminals and check for corrosion at least every 100 hours. Replace the battery if it shows signs of failure.
- Hydraulic Filters: Change hydraulic filters every 1000 hours to maintain the performance and longevity of the hydraulic system.
Sticking to these intervals will help maintain peak performance and minimize downtime. Always follow the manufacturer’s recommended schedule and use genuine parts for replacements.
